24 #include <stdio.h>
25 #include <string.h>
26 #include <errno.h>
27
28 #include "test.h"
29 #include "tst_process_state.h"
30
tst_process_state_wait(const char * file,const int lineno,void (* cleanup_fn)(void),pid_t pid,const char state,unsigned int msec_timeout)31 int tst_process_state_wait(const char *file, const int lineno,
32 void (*cleanup_fn)(void), pid_t pid,
33 const char state, unsigned int msec_timeout)
34 {
35 char proc_path[128], cur_state;
36 unsigned int msecs = 0;
37
38 snprintf(proc_path, sizeof(proc_path), "/proc/%i/stat", pid);
39
40 for (;;) {
41 safe_file_scanf(file, lineno, cleanup_fn, proc_path,
42 "%*i %*s %c", &cur_state);
43
44 if (state == cur_state)
45 break;
46
47 usleep(1000);
48 msecs += 1;
49
50 if (msec_timeout && msecs >= msec_timeout) {
51 errno = ETIMEDOUT;
52 return -1;
53 }
54 }
55
56 return 0;
57 }
58
tst_process_state_wait2(pid_t pid,const char state)59 int tst_process_state_wait2(pid_t pid, const char state)
60 {
61 char proc_path[128], cur_state;
62
63 snprintf(proc_path, sizeof(proc_path), "/proc/%i/stat", pid);
64
65 for (;;) {
66 FILE *f = fopen(proc_path, "r");
67 if (!f) {
68 fprintf(stderr, "Failed to open '%s': %s\n",
69 proc_path, strerror(errno));
70 return 1;
71 }
72
73 if (fscanf(f, "%*i %*s %c", &cur_state) != 1) {
74 fclose(f);
75 fprintf(stderr, "Failed to read '%s': %s\n",
76 proc_path, strerror(errno));
77 return 1;
78 }
79 fclose(f);
80
81 if (state == cur_state)
82 return 0;
83
84 usleep(10000);
85 }
86 }
